RFLP map of soybean

2001
The soybean is one of the oldest cultivated crops. It first emerged as a domesticated plant around the 11th century B.C. (Hymowitz 1970), although references to soybean appear in books written over 4500 years ago (Smith and Huyser 1987). The soybean was first planted in the United States in Thunderbolt, GA, in 1765 (Hymowitz and Harlan 1983).

RFLP maps of barley

1994
Barley, Hordeum vulgare L., is among the oldest cultivated crops dating 5000 to 7000 years B.C. (Clark 1967; Harlan 1976, 1979) and perhaps much older (Wendorf et al. 1979). Barley has also been a favorite genetic experimental organism since the rediscovery of Mendel’s laws of heredity (Tschermak 1901; cited from Smith 1951).
